After the unfortunate passing of long-time editor Barbara Heath in early September, The Townships Sun magazine has announced its new editor, Rachel Garber.
“We are happy to welcome Rachel to the Townships Sun team, and we look forward to growing the magazine together,” said David Wright, the president of the board.
“My passions are writing, photography and art,” said Garber. “And I love living in the Townships. It’s a match made in heaven to work on The Townships Sun. I’m really happy to have landed here.”
Garber has lived the Eastern Townships for the past 25 years, specifically in the erstwhile hamlet of Maple Leaf, in the Haut-Saint-François MRC. She has written for a number of publications, including The Townships Sun, The Record and the Journal Le-Haut-Saint-François, where she has a regular column. She previously lived for 22 years in Montreal, and before that, in Ontario, Ohio, Virginia, Philadelphia, Somalia, and Toronto.
